Composite Number

24128

24128 is a even composite number that follows 24127 and precedes 24129. It is composed of 28 distinct factors: 1, 2, 4, 8, 13, 16, 26, 29, 32, 52, 58, 64, 104, 116, 208, 232, 377, 416, 464, 754, 832, 928, 1508, 1856, 3016, 6032, 12064, 24128. Its prime factorization can be written as 2^6 × 13 × 29. 24128 is classified as a abundant number based on the sum of its proper divisors. In computer science, 24128 is represented as 101111001000000 in binary and 5E40 in hexadecimal.
